Ministry of Transport announces a $22 million investment for upgrades to Route 10 in New Brunswick

The quality of Canada’s transportation infrastructure and the efficiency of the country’s trade corridors is key to the success of Canadian firms in the global marketplace.

...the Honourable Marc Garneau, Minister of Transport announced a major investment of $22.062 million for upgrades to Route 10 that will help local businesses compete by moving commercial goods to market, and create more jobs for the middle class.

The project involves replacing two existing bridges on Route 10 in Coles Island, located in southcentral New Brunswick. The two bridges will be removed and replaced with new structures that can accommodate two lanes of traffic and will meet forestry industry standards for vehicle weights and increase the fluidity of trade at this strategic transportation corridor. The Strategic Corridor Project – Route 10, Coles Island is a project of the Government of New Brunswick...

This is excerpted from 11 April 2018 news release by Transport Canada.
